Safety, Security, Risk management

  • Ensure all policies are established, effectively communicated to staff and a monitoring mechanism is implemented.
  • Ensure all safety records are stored, maintained, and updated regularly. UCCA to be informed of any breaches as may be required by regulation.
  • Liaise with departments to solve challenges related to safety and security.
  • Assist operations staff in reducing or changing risky and harmful lifestyle behavior.
  • Make sure there is a safety and security register in place.
  • Ascertain that all potential risks are analyzed, and mitigation measures are in place.
  • Train the committee members to keep abreast with current aviation risk management practices.
  • Recommend training to HR for all departments where necessary.

Operations Strategy

  • Work with all departments to formulate a functional operations strategy; commercial, Engineering, Flight Operations, and Ground operations are critical in this.
  • Develop an operations performance scoreboard (matrix) to measure progress.
  • Regularly evaluate the performance of the airline and with senior management, make sustainable and meaningful recommendations.
  • Benchmark from other Airlines for best practice approaches.
  • Set up operations review strategy meetings with key departments to update the CEO on a regular basis
  • Implement the four Disciplines of Strategy Execution training for the operations team.
  • Periodically review the performance of the Airline by route, schedule, and other parameters for maximization.
  • Work with the operations aspects of the outstations to ascertain smooth workings and address challenges.

Budgets and control

  • Participate in the write-up of the operational budgets in liaison with all departments.
  • Ensure all expenses are in line with the budget and assist in expediting some approvals.
  • Ensure all financial accountabilities are accurate, timely, and ethical.
  • Participate in budgetary reviews with the relevant teams regularly.
  • Negotiating contracts, agreements, and partnerships with vendors where applicable to ensure value for money.

Operational feedback communication

  • Commitment to delivering exceptional customer experience.
  • Maintaining awareness and a sound knowledge of operational developments, theory and methods and providing suitable feedback to Heads, managers and staff within Uganda Airlines.
  • Collection of feedback from staff regarding operations improvements to the principle of inclusive leadership.
  • Display of all operations matrices and score cards for the general information of all staff.
  • Motivating and encouraging all operations staff to participate in companywide initiatives to improve the airline.
  • Work with commercial and PR to ensure the external stakeholders have the right information.
  • Collaborate closely with department leaders to prepare board documents for submission and defend the proposed airline initiatives.

Relationship management

  • Maintaining good relationships with all the airline regulatory bodies and other Government Ministries; IATA, ICAO, UCAA, and other missions.
  • Ensure that the Airline can benefit from all possible relations to prosper in business.

Compliance and Monitoring

  • Work with all the heads of departments to ensure that the Airline is compliant in all aspects within the operations sphere.
  • Ensure that all personnel in the operations departments undergo the mandatory training.

IT Systems Accuracy

  • Work with the IT department to ensure smooth IT operations for our passengers and staff.
